Core concepts

Concept 1

A service offering can combine goods, access to resources and service actions for a target consumer group.

Exam cue: Identify which organisation is providing and which is consuming in the scenario.

Concept 2

Service provision covers provider activities and resources, while service consumption covers consumer activities and resources.

Exam cue: Look for the combination of goods, access and actions in an offering.

Concept 3

Service relationship management is the joint work used to support continuing value co-creation.

Memory anchors

Service offering

A description for a target group that may include goods, resource access and service actions.

Provision and consumption

Provider and consumer each contribute activities and resources to the relationship.

Relationship management

The parties maintain cooperation so value can continue to be co-created.
